数码之家

 找回密码
 立即注册
搜索
查看: 9129|回复: 45

[慧荣] Teclast台电锋芒PRO-64GB简拆短接量产提取原厂固件-这盘很“奇妙”

[复制链接]
发表于 2020-3-31 16:55:39 | 显示全部楼层 |阅读模式

爱科技、爱创意、爱折腾、爱极致,我们都是技术控

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 星空飞碟 于 2020-4-4 15:18 编辑

前述:
一共前后买了三个64GB锋芒U盘,每个基本上都是二十多元,全是主控3268+三星UFS。其中一个到手就量产了,原速写入40MB-50MB左右,读取100MB-110MB左右,加Force DDR量产后,速度上升了一些,SMI不支持UASP加速,但Win10下测速曾经一次最高写入70MB-80MB左右,读取130MB-140MB左右,XPWin7下速度稍低一些(用另外一台PC-Win10原生USB3.0测试,转接卡速度低一点,以下截图基本上都是XP下量产的图片,因为折腾时间较长有的没有截图)。量产之前原厂坏块114,量产之后坏块减少至26,容量扩充了一些。


现象:
非常奇葩,其实细想也不奇葩。量产工具前后用过不少于6个版本,包括融合版和单版与高低版新老版,采用的方式高格和低格,量产次数至少几十次。反正就拿这个盘玩,如果玩坏了就扔掉。疫情期间,没法售后。
量产很容易,成功率非常高。但实际应用测试之中问题不断:或者丢盘,或者无法格式化,或者无盘符插入,或者失去驱动,或者USB3.0变身USB2.0等等,但都不丢数据。量产过程中可能出现的是:变化不断,或者呈现64GBMLC变成128GBTLC,或者坏块几百上千数,或者在容量原始设置状态下容量减半至32GB,甚至到16GB。超级撩人心扉。

过程:
先论坛里打包版的高格,量产时间很快,大概120S左右(如果量产MLC64GB变成TLC128GB的话,再次量产则需要3000S-4000S的时间,不管是否打开PRESCAN),成功后软件测试速度上来了,马上进行跑圈测试,一般都是先H2testw走一遍,再后Urwtest跑一次,都没有问题,然后再拷贝几部电影看看,MD5校验加随意观影,均正常。实际观察使用几天,如果没有问题,基本就算过了。

第二天,插上U盘,出问题了,找不到驱动,拔出再插,显示盘符,不能格式化,再来很插一次,什么都木有,歇菜了。换端口,前置U3换后置U3口,还是出现问题,故障是随机的,再换HUB连接,依然如故。换另外几台电脑,换操作系统,结果都一样的。有时候插入正常,可以打开,而复制文件的时候,就掉盘了,或,打开正常,使用的时候,突然U3.0变成U2.0。总之,有什么来什么。有心理预期,因为高格嘛,F如果品质不好,难说,即使跑圈过了也不代表可以正常使用多久。
马上换量产版本低格,包括后来N多次低格量产,量产时间4000S-9000S都有,每次量产都能成功。量产完成之后,先测速,再跑圈,实际复制文件删除文件,有几个结果:要么很正常,要么使用之中,掉盘,要么不识别,完全看U盘的“心情”。但测试大都没有问题,问题出在使用之中。这其中,还有一些现象,在量产工具设置一致的情况下,量产成功之后,容量减半32GB,甚至容量变成16GB,或者,变成128GB的TLC。为了测试问题,在版本一致设置一致的情况下,连续三次量产,每次都结果不一。还有就是,量产成功之后,最多连续跑圈5次,都不出问题,结果使用就出问题。手上已有很多优盘,也经常量产,这种现象第一次遇到。
为了找到原因,先软后硬,换版本,调设置,重复量产,把能设置关联的,预设Pretest,预扫Prescan,ECC,速度,容量原始、定容、固定,增加坏块比例,ISP,CID,取消DDR,电流,总之,都过一遍,结果都会出现以上一些故障,只不过有时候连续几天都正常,再过两天,又出现了,大多是掉盘。其间,风扇直吹过,端口更换过,都一样的货色。
后来,低格不行,再来换高格版一次,结果直接变砖,插上没有任何反应。

拆解:
正好可以拆解了,看看硬件有什么问题没有,接触是否完好。无损拆解很容易,一把小的扁平螺丝刀按压就可以抽出。放大镜仔细观察了一下,表面上看没有看出有什么问题。
001.jpg

我这个主控是SM3268P,48脚位,支持4CE,有的坛友的是3268M,64脚支持8CE。
003.jpg

三星UFS闪存-UFS153球64G字库KLUCG4J1CB-B0B1-MLC UFS2.0 64GB 11.5x13x1.0
004.jpg
SA.jpg
005.jpg

3268短接再插入USB口,识别正常了。
007.jpg
006.jpg

如果主控没有瑕疵,主板没有问题,F品质尚可,接触没有不良,发热不大,那可能就是量产工具版本ISP的问题。分析了一下,有几次量产之后,曾经连续几天都可以正常使用,且发热也不大,基本可以排除硬件的故障,当然也可能F品质不太好。那软件上,就只有量产工具版本及固件了,都说台电的固件很奇怪,量产后容易出现问题,试试提取原厂固件看看吧。从另外一个没有量产的64GB里提取。提取如下:
009.jpg
选定删除无效垃圾代码
010.jpg
替换BIN
011.jpg
012.jpg

上电再量产,一次成功,固件版本变了,又是测速,又是跑圈,又是复制文件,搁置两天再测试,没有问题。
SMI003.png
SMI002.png
SMI004.png

再分析下,新买的U盘,到手坏块数量是114,量产后就减少了(最少26,依据设置,偶有35也有过),这有点问题,必定,厂方的量产是批量的,要求也应该是严格筛选坏块,稳定是最重要的其次才是速度。所以,还是必须找出坏块。ECC设置,4-12都测试过,不管数值高低,坏块基本无变化,只有某次选择6,坏块突然变成几百个,但还是没用。Erase all block再加Erase good block,不行,坏块不变。Erase all block+55AA原始直接量产,还是26,定容,53个,85个,91个,101个等,最后系BIN定量搞定(这里还有一个奇异状况,如果设定容量减少太多,却不一定通过甚至坏块几百上千),经过计算,参考其他两个U盘,最后114搞定。至此,无论怎么玩,怎么测试,怎么实写,怎么乱搞,最极端的搞法还故意运行之中强行拔出然后反复插拔,都再没有出现异常情况了。成功后十多天了,每天试试,都没有出现任何问题。速度上写入比出厂高一些,读取降低了一点,但都比不上曾经量产此U盘成功后最高的一次测速。
SMI005.png

曾经量产通过,实际使用不能过的设置。
Old-2.50.7C.png
Old-2.50.7B.png
Old-2.50.7A.png

最近,想用另外一个最新的固件再玩玩,强制选定ISP再次量产加BIN定量,成功后,已有两三天了,暂时还没有出现问题。现在还在观察之中......
NEW-2.50.7C.png
NEW-2.50.7B.png
NEW-2.50.7D.png
NEW-2.50.7A.png

测试跑圈
NEW-2.50.7F.png
NEW-2.50.7G.png

总结:
这个优盘前后折腾花费了一个多月的时间,终于搞定。最大的感受就是U盘要稳定才是最重要,速度其次。如果要兼而有之,那就碰运气看这个优盘的品质了。
台电的U盘,如果可以正常使用,最好不要量产,特别是UFS的盘,除非买的U盘F品控非常好,坏块较少,随意量产,可能问题不大。
台电的U盘,如果量产后,坏块变少,一定要注意了,切勿保存重要文件,莫名其妙的问题可能随时出现。这个U盘,最初始低格量产成功后,连续测速,实际拷贝,跑圈多次,都可以通过,也许这一天都没有问题,放置一两天后,可能又会出现问题,会搞得你吐血,呵呵。
台电的U盘,固件可能不是太大的问题,我测试过,以最新版本v70-6为例,量产工具默认选择的固件版本,我强制点选了另外一个ISP固件,当然是和原F与ID相关联的,依然通过,使用上也没有问题。但原厂的固件加坏块数量相同的量产确实是使用这么久最稳定的。
针对这个U盘,量产工具的版本在同一设置一致的情况下,速度有一点变化,经过测试这个优盘那个单版高格后速度最快。低格方式可以识别正常量产的情况下,区别不是太大。版本太低没有固件支持不识别。
有的量产版本,在设置原始容量的情况下,抓取的坏块多一些,但不能达到出厂的块数。坏块数减少量产后容量增添,但极不稳定。量产可以备份原厂坏块数,重新量产可以对比坏块数值与位置。
开启强制DDR后,速度确实快一些,不过,发热也稍大一点,稳定性基本没有问题。
SM驱动支持的操作系统,量产基本无异。不管是原系统还是VHD或者RAM。
这个慧荣主控U盘可以随意玩,只要硬件不死,就不会有问题。

操作系统的测速比较:
Image 1.png
Image 2.png
XP
as-ssd-WinXP.png
NEW-2.50.7H.png
NEW-2.50.7E.png
WIn7
as-ssd-Win7.png
Win8.1
as-ssd-Win8.png
Win10
as-ssd-Win10.png

此盘使用过的其中一些量产工具及提取的固件:链接: https://pan.baidu.com/s/1BXZDKASTSD0NA4ZzDg_Nrg
提取码: yq3u

有坛友问及提取原厂固件:
1打开量产工具文件夹,删除量产工具自带的ISP读取校验文件:ISPChecksumRead.bin(不删也行可以被覆盖)
2新U盘,没有量产之前,插入USB口,然后打开量产工具,点击扫描USB-scan usb
3点击盘位,出现dialog对话框,然后关闭。这样会自动重生ISPChecksumRead.bin这个文件
4打开反汇编进制工具,此类工具网上很多,比如C32Asm,导入16进制ISPChecksumRead.bin
5再导入一个量产工具默认的ISP版本,作为对照参考。
6以C32Asm为例,左边序码位,查看默认版本最后一位的代码,中间数据不用管,右边对照搜索最后一位相同字符串,一般最后面的全是000000...之类的基本无用。然后对照删除即可。
7固件大小可以参考,比如这个版本的固件大小为153 KB (156,672 字节)
8量产版本不同,固件大小不一,如集合版为151 KB (154,624 字节),所以,哪个版本提取的固件最好就用那个版本量产。
9量产工具正片和黑片的固件不能通用。

今天正在回复坛友,闲时又把前几天量产成功后的U盘插上看看情况,结果就出问题了,变身TLC128G,固件丢失。前两天每天上电检测都还是正常的。这个固件版本是量产时指定选择,量产工具自带,非默认固件,也非原厂固件。看来还得重新刷入原厂固件。
Image 1.png
Image 2.png

打赏

参与人数 5家元 +61 收起 理由
aping365 + 10
zhuyimin + 10 優秀文章
家睦 + 30
fanallen + 10 挺能折腾的
chenzoutie + 1 謝謝分享

查看全部打赏

发表于 2020-3-31 18:08:54 | 显示全部楼层
本帖最后由 源782529 于 2020-3-31 21:01 编辑

纠正一下,这上面的三星UFS不是BGA153,是BGA95的,BGA153的UFS只能上SM3350
回复 支持 反对

使用道具 举报

发表于 2020-3-31 18:42:07 来自手机浏览器 | 显示全部楼层
请教一下,台电原厂固件,怎么才能提取出了呢?
回复 支持 1 反对 0

使用道具 举报

发表于 2020-3-31 18:48:08 来自手机浏览器 | 显示全部楼层
好像在某部落看到过这类操作
回复 支持 反对

使用道具 举报

发表于 2020-3-31 19:18:41 来自手机浏览器 | 显示全部楼层
之前是哪个说量产减少坏块还比厂家牛逼的  
回复 支持 1 反对 0

使用道具 举报

发表于 2020-3-31 19:27:10 来自手机浏览器 | 显示全部楼层
这个盘包装日期是多少?我64g是12月3号非正片ufs,检验文件存了3个月,检验没问题,没出现过掉盘情况。。。低格选r1219那个版本。。有个32g的ufs推拉壳用了一年都正常,很稳定,速度85/130左右
回复 支持 反对

使用道具 举报

发表于 2020-3-31 19:39:01 来自手机浏览器 | 显示全部楼层
我手里大概十几个台电ufs的。32g和64g都有,需要固件可以私聊我,有高格和低格2版本,你可以再测试下
回复 支持 反对

使用道具 举报

发表于 2020-3-31 19:49:51 来自手机浏览器 | 显示全部楼层
大佬从哪买的这么便宜?不会是咸鱼吧?
回复 支持 反对

使用道具 举报

发表于 2020-3-31 20:49:23 | 显示全部楼层
楼主研究的很详细 有很高的参考价值
回复 支持 反对

使用道具 举报

发表于 2020-3-31 21:13:09 | 显示全部楼层
本帖最后由 tiansw1 于 2020-3-31 21:14 编辑

好腻害!最佩服的是楼主的逻辑性。要是我,这么折腾,几次下来就蒙圈了。手里也有ufs的盘,一直就没敢动。
回复 支持 反对

使用道具 举报

发表于 2020-3-31 22:12:50 | 显示全部楼层
华634579 发表于 2020-3-31 19:49
大佬从哪买的这么便宜?不会是咸鱼吧?

之前有过特价,29.9,加上淘宝特价版或者一些红包能干到25左右,狠点的10多块都可以
回复 支持 反对

使用道具 举报

发表于 2020-3-31 22:13:47 | 显示全部楼层
本帖最后由 yanyan171 于 2020-3-31 22:16 编辑

我手上有三个台电的锋芒,一个是32G的老锋芒,一个是64G的锋芒PRO,另一个是劣化版的幻影X 64G
都是3268+UFS


我倒是关心的是怎么开出128G出来,TLC容量翻倍比MLC更爽,我喜欢容量大
回复 支持 反对

使用道具 举报

发表于 2020-3-31 22:43:29 | 显示全部楼层
我也想问一下,原厂固件如何提取的,是按容量153KB,把后面的代码都删除吗?
回复 支持 1 反对 0

使用道具 举报

发表于 2020-3-31 22:44:56 来自手机浏览器 | 显示全部楼层
我这几天在京东买的几个64G1月8日、9日批次全是3268加三星UFS 8CE的
回复 支持 反对

使用道具 举报

发表于 2020-4-1 05:41:38 来自手机浏览器 | 显示全部楼层
lozy3 发表于 2020-3-31 22:43
我也想问一下,原厂固件如何提取的,是按容量153KB,把后面的代码都删除吗? ...

不是按大小哦,我的3267U盘已经刷死了,量产工具不识别了。短接还没搞好,今天继续,实在不行就拆了清空颗粒。早知道就直接拿颗粒在测试架研究了,用另一片颗粒实验成功了。
回复 支持 反对

使用道具 举报

发表于 2020-4-1 10:43:50 | 显示全部楼层
这种量产工具只能在XP系统上使用吗
回复 支持 反对

使用道具 举报

垃圾数码之家 该用户已被删除
发表于 2020-4-1 10:55:50 来自手机浏览器 | 显示全部楼层
我也想知道原厂固件提取方法
回复 支持 反对

使用道具 举报

发表于 2020-4-1 13:48:59 来自手机浏览器 | 显示全部楼层
昨晚提取固件刷死的3267+9ddl,已经短接救活了。找酒精擦擦,原来有焊油接触不良,没短上
回复 支持 反对

使用道具 举报

发表于 2020-4-1 14:02:07 | 显示全部楼层
zxc000ly 发表于 2020-4-1 05:41
不是按大小哦,我的3267U盘已经刷死了,量产工具不识别了。短接还没搞好,今天继续,实在不行就拆了清空 ...

我用winhex做了比较,提取的固件和量产工具中的固件差距很大,头是一样的,尾部根本抓不到,没有一样的地方,不知道从哪删除。
回复 支持 反对

使用道具 举报

发表于 2020-4-1 14:18:04 | 显示全部楼层
有一个锋芒128的 SM3269AB 加闪迪453C95937A51  本来还想着量产了,这样看还是继续用吧:sweat:
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

APP|手机版|小黑屋|关于我们|联系我们|法律条款|技术知识分享平台

闽公网安备35020502000485号

闽ICP备2021002735号-2

GMT+8, 2024-4-20 13:24 , Processed in 0.249600 second(s), 12 queries , Redis On.

Powered by Discuz!

© 2006-2023 smzj.net

快速回复 返回顶部 返回列表